In this episode, Dr. Lorne Brown sits down with psychiatrist and neurotechnology expert Dr. Cody Rall to explore the rapidly evolving world of brain optimization, wearable technology, meditation, burnout recovery, and cognitive performance. Drawing on his experience as a Navy-trained psychiatrist and founder of Tech For Psych, Cody explains how tools like EEG, heart rate variability tracking, neurofeedback, and photobiomodulation can help us better understand brain function and build resilience.
The conversation dives into burnout, brain flexibility, meditation, psychedelics, red light therapy, and the future of personalized health coaching. Together, they examine how objective data can guide meaningful behavior change while emphasizing that technology works best when combined with daily practices that support long-term mental and emotional well-being.
Key Takeaways:
- Brain health is less about performance and more about adaptability and recovery.
- Wearable technology can provide valuable insights, but context and coaching remain essential.
- Burnout often reflects an inability to shift between “go mode” and “rest mode.”
- Meditation, sleep, movement, and emotional processing remain foundational—even with advanced technology.
- Photobiomodulation and neurotechnology may help support cognition, recovery, and resilience when used consistently and appropriately.

Dr. Cody Rall’s Bio:
Dr. Cody Rall, M.D., is a United States Navy trained Psychiatrist who specializes in neurotechnology wearables. He is a co-founder of Stanford Brainstorm, the world’s first academic laboratory dedicated to transforming brain health through entrepreneurship.
Dr. Rall also served as a selection judge and team member of the psychiatry innovation lab, an annual national competition at the American Psychiatric Association that works as an incubator for groups developing technological solutions to problems in mental health care.
